      https://doc.pfsense.org/index.php/OpenVPN_with_RADIUS_via_Active_Directory

      Trying to follow this guide to the T. For some reason I keep getting this error on the laptop I want to connect to the VPN:

      [5] GOT: ">LOG:1457750375,N,VERIFY ERROR: depth=0,error=unsupported certificate purpose:…...."

      I've tried re-creating the cert any no luck. Any idea what I am doing wrong?

      I'm on the newest PFSense version, and using the newest windows x86 vpn client

      edit hours later

      oh ffs. The guide has a typo that messed me up. The first cert you make after the CA, needs to be a server cert, but the guide states to make it a user cert.
